Compare the rivalry schools - University of Akron Main Campus and Kent State University at Kent.

University of Akron Main Campus is a Public, 4-years school located in Akron, OH and Kent State University at Kent is a Public, 4-years school located in Kent, OH.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• Kent State University at Kent has higher submitted SAT score (1,100) than University of Akron Main Campus (1,090).
  • University of Akron Main Campus (82.87% acceptance rate) is tighter than Kent State University at Kent (88.02%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• Kent State University at Kent (25,854 students) is larger than University of Akron Main Campus (13,465 students).
  • Kent State University at Kent has more expensive tuition & fees of $22,316 than University of Akron Main Campus($17,239).
  • Kent State University at Kent has more full-time faculties of 930 faculties than University of Akron Main Campus(476 facluties).
